Career path

Career Role (Ocean Climate Change Adaptation - UK) Description
Marine Spatial Planner Develop and implement strategies for sustainable ocean use, crucial for climate change mitigation and adaptation. High demand for expertise in spatial analysis and policy.
Coastal Engineer (Climate Resilience) Design and build resilient coastal defenses, employing innovative solutions to protect communities from rising sea levels and extreme weather events. Requires strong engineering and climate modeling skills.
Ocean Data Scientist Analyze vast oceanographic datasets to model climate impacts and inform adaptation strategies. Expertise in programming, statistical modeling, and climate science is essential.
Climate Change Consultant (Marine Environment) Advise businesses and governments on climate risks and adaptation strategies for the marine sector. Requires strong communication and consulting skills alongside climate change expertise.
Marine Renewable Energy Specialist Develop and deploy sustainable ocean energy solutions like offshore wind and tidal energy – vital for reducing carbon emissions. Expertise in renewable energy technologies is key.
